Easements, legal agreements that grant the right to use a portion of a property for a specific purpose, can have far-reaching consequences on the overall value and marketability of a real estate asset. Whether it's a utility easement, a conservation easement, or a right-of-way, the financial implications can be substantial and can make or break a real estate transaction.

🧮 Theoretical Framework & Mathematical Methodology (Detail every variable)

The Easement Cost Impact Calculator is built upon a robust theoretical framework that takes into account the key variables influencing the financial implications of an easement. Let's delve into the mathematical methodology behind this powerful tool:

  1. Market Value (MV): This input represents the current market value of the property in question. It is a crucial factor in determining the overall impact of an easement, as the percentage decrease in value will be directly proportional to the property's initial worth.

  2. Easement Impact (EI): This variable represents the estimated percentage decrease in the property's market value due to the presence of the easement. This figure can vary widely depending on the type of easement, its location, and the specific restrictions it imposes on the use of the property.

    The Easement Impact (EI) is typically influenced by factors such as:

    • The size and location of the easement within the property
    • The type of easement (e.g., utility, conservation, right-of-way)
    • The degree of restriction on the property owner's use of the affected area
    • The potential impact on the property's development or redevelopment potential
    • The perceived desirability and marketability of the property with the easement in place
  3. Maintenance Costs (MC): This input represents the estimated annual costs associated with maintaining the easement area. These costs can include, but are not limited to, landscaping, repairs, and any necessary inspections or compliance measures.

    The Maintenance Costs (MC) can be influenced by factors such as:

    • The size and complexity of the easement area
    • The specific maintenance requirements stipulated in the easement agreement
    • The availability and cost of local service providers
    • The frequency of required maintenance activities

The Easement Cost Impact Calculator uses these three variables to provide a comprehensive analysis of the financial implications of an easement. The core calculation is as follows:

Estimated Decrease in Market Value = Market Value (MV) × Easement Impact (EI)
Annual Maintenance Costs = Maintenance Costs (MC)

🏥 Comprehensive Case Study (Step-by-step example)

To illustrate the practical application of the Easement Cost Impact Calculator, let's consider a comprehensive case study:

Property Details:

  • Location: Suburban residential neighborhood
  • Market Value (MV): $500,000
  • Easement Type: Utility easement for power lines

Easement Characteristics:

  • Size of Easement Area: 2,000 square feet (approximately 10% of the total property)
  • Restrictions: No permanent structures or landscaping allowed within the easement area

Estimated Easement Impact (EI):

  • Based on market research and analysis of similar properties, the estimated Easement Impact (EI) is 15%.

Estimated Maintenance Costs (MC):

  • Annual maintenance costs for the easement area, including periodic tree trimming and inspections, are estimated at $2,000.

Using the Easement Cost Impact Calculator, we can now calculate the potential financial implications:

  1. Estimated Decrease in Market Value:

    • Estimated Decrease in Market Value = Market Value (MV) × Easement Impact (EI)
    • Estimated Decrease in Market Value = $500,000 × 0.15 = $75,000

    The presence of the utility easement is estimated to decrease the property's market value by $75,000.

  2. Annual Maintenance Costs:

    • Annual Maintenance Costs = Maintenance Costs (MC)
    • Annual Maintenance Costs = $2,000

    The property owner will be responsible for an annual maintenance cost of $2,000 to maintain the easement area.

By understanding the potential decrease in market value and the ongoing maintenance costs associated with the easement, the property owner can make an informed decision about whether to proceed with the purchase or negotiate more favorable terms with the seller.

Tax Implications:

  • The presence of an easement may affect the property's assessed value for tax purposes, which can impact the owner's tax liability.
  • Certain types of easements, such as conservation easements, may provide tax benefits or incentives for the property owner.
  • Consulting with a tax professional can help ensure the calculator's outputs are properly accounted for in the property's tax planning.
